Plugin authors: the Quillmark calendar bridge is dropping connections when two sync agents write overlapping event windows. The conflict resolver locks the events table, the second agent times out, and the plugin SDK reports it as a network failure instead of a lock wait. Fix lands in SDK 2.9: lock waits will surface as a distinct retryable error. Until then, serialize your sync jobs per calendar. To test against staging, use the database reachable at the connection string below.

replica DSN, tajep-hagug: mysql://novath_svc:CR@db-85cb.torvaforge.example:5432/prair

Onboarding: migrating the Larkspindle service to the Hermetica build system. Hermetica builds run in a sealed sandbox, so any network fetches your old Make targets relied on must be declared as pinned inputs in the manifest. Dependency checksums live in deps.lock; regenerate them with the vendoring tool whenever versions change. The sandbox also can't read your shell profile, so the artifact-registry credential must appear in the project's env file, on the following line.

vault entry, yahif-yajep: COURIER_KEY29=b802bdf8034096b65a51c6ba5abe2

Subject: ChipStream cut-over complete

Plugin authors —

Cut-over to ChipStream v4 finished last night. Old ingest endpoint is dead. Mat readers at the Bellvale course now stream through the new decoder; plugins built against the v3 SDK must rebuild against v4 before Sunday's race. Event hooks are unchanged; payload timestamps are now milliseconds, not seconds. Test against the staging reader sim before going live. For local testing, point your plugin at a service running these configuration values.

service settings:
PRAIX_LOG_LEVEL=error
PRAIX_METRICS_HOST=metrics.praix.qorvelcorp.corp
PRAIX_POOL_SIZE=16